QEngineKit

QEngineKit is an open-source persistent task queue for Swift (iOS/macOS/visionOS), built on SwiftData and Swift actors — crash-safe background jobs with capped concurrency, priority ordering, and exponential-backoff retries with jitter.

  • Crash-safe persistenceEvery job is persisted in SwiftData and execution state is rebuilt on launch, so work enqueued before a crash resumes after it.
  • Device-aware schedulingPer-kind constraints (network, unmetered, charging) gate tasks without consuming retry attempts, with live NWPathMonitor integration re-evaluating the queue on connectivity changes.
  • At-least-once delivery with crash recoveryInterrupted tasks are detected and re-queued on launch, with per-task timeouts raced via structured task groups, dedup keys, delayed execution, and cooperative cancellation.
